About Shinichiro Ohta

  • Shinichiro Ohta (?? ???, Ota Shin'ichiro, born March 20, 1971) is a Japanese voice actor and television announcer noted primarily in the West for his appearance as the kitchen reporter in Iron Chef, where he was known for his rapid-fire announcing style.
  • On the English language version of Iron Chef, which aired on Food Network, Ohta's dialogue is dubbed by American voice actor Jeff Manning.
  • Ohta's character is perhaps best known for his line, "Fukui-san?" (Mr.
  • Fukui), which he would say several times per episode, when interrupting Kenji Fukui's commentary with a report from the field.
  • His talent agency is Aoni Production.
